New Cassette advice 5600 vs 5700
#1
Hi, I am looking at buying a new cassette but am not sure what some of the detailing numbers mean. I would like to buy a Shimano 105 cassette 10 speed but there is a version that's 5600 and one that's 5700, could someone please tell me what's the difference.
  Reply
#2
The 5700 will be the latest model and maybe a few grams lighter. Shifting and performance wise I doubt that you could tell the difference when riding.
They booth have the largest 3 sprockets mounted on an alloy carrier etc.
